Strawberry Shortcake
This is such a perfect treat at this time of year!
A shortcake is very similar to an English scone but made with egg and cream instead of milk to form the dough.
This recipe makes about 7 x 7.5cm shortcakes Continue reading “Strawberry Shortcake”

Raspberry Cheesecake
It has taken me quite a while to find and perfect my cheesecakes, when I say perfect…. to make them the way my family and I like them. A while back my mum developed a cough every time she ate shop bought cakes and biscuits. When I stated making cheesecakes it soon became clear that I couldn’t use crushed biscuits for the base or it would result in a lot of suffering. I experimented with various bases and our favourites are a short bread (please see my shortbread recipe) or an oaty crumble base which I have used in this recipe for you. Because I cook the base do allow plenty of time for cooling and refrigerating. Continue reading “Raspberry Cheesecake”
